2010-11-29 5 views

答えて

2

はい、以前のiPhoneモデル用にサイズが変更された画像は、カスタムデザインのiPhone 4画像と比べるとちょっと変わって見えます。

+0

これはビットマップにのみ適用されます。プログラムで描画されたグラフィックスとベクターグラフィックスは自動的に拡大/縮小されます。 – BoltClock

+0

@BoltClock:良い点。私は "480x320"を見て、ただ "イメージ"を仮定しました。 –

4

はい、変更なしで実行できます。

「網膜」アセットを作成する場合は、すべての画像を2倍の解像度で作成し、アプリケーションバンドルのファイル名に「@ 2x」を加えたコピーを含めることができます。 iPhoneは自動的に正しい画像を読み込みます。

例: 既存の画像 - myImage.png 新しいアップサンプリングされた画像 - [email protected]

0

iPhone 4と古いデバイスの両方がコアグラフィック座標系であり、サイズが320×480ポイントでありますUIKitが使用します。あなたのソフトウェアは同じように動作します。

ビットマップとディスプレイの自動スケーリングのみが異なります。ビットマップされたコンテンツや画像を持っている場合は、オプションで@ 2xサイズのバージョンを提供することができます。これは、iPhone 4デバイスで2倍のスケーリングを行うことなくややスムーズに見えます。これはいいですが、オプションです。

関連する問題